The processing apparatus prevents difficulty in separation of the substrate from the base because of charges on the substrate when the substrate is lifted from the base for substrate placing during processing. The processing apparatus comprises pins to lift up the substrate on the base and a neutralization apparatus to discharge ionized gas to the gap between the bottom of the substrate lifted from the base by the pins and the top of the base. A processing apparatus is provided for cleaning a wafer W. In the apparatus, a carbonated solution in the form of mist is ejected onto the wafer W through a nozzle 41, so that the film of carbonated solution, i.e., a conductive liquid film is formed on the wafer W. Next, a pure water highly pressurized by a jet pump 47 is ejected on the wafer W for cleaning it. When forming a metallization layer in integrated-circuit semiconductor device fabrication, metal such as tungsten, for example, adheres poorly to a dielectric such as, e.g., silicon oxide, and tends to flake off from wafer areas not covered by a glue layer. Processing of the invention prevents such flaking by, first, removing the dielectric from the back side, edge, and "clip-mark" areas of the wafer and, second, depositing a glue layer on remaining dielectric on the face of the wafer. Tobacco material having a reduced protein content is provided by first extracting water soluble components from tobacco. The extracted residue then is subjected to enzyme treatment using an enzyme which can decompose water insoluble protein molecules to smaller sized water soluble molecular components.
